1970 Alfa Romeo Junior | 1994 Porsche Karisma | |
Make | Alfa Romeo | Porsche |
Model | Junior | Karisma |
Year Released | 1970 | 1994 |
Engine Size | 1290 cc | 3600 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| boxer |
Valves per Cylinder | 2 valves | 2 valves |
Horse Power | 86 HP | 268 HP |
Engine RPM | 6000 RPM | 6100 RPM |
Torque | 115 Nm | 336 Nm |
Torque RPM | 3200 RPM | 5000 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
